The Importance of Education in Shaping Our Future

Education is a fundamental right that has been recognized as essential for the development and progress of individuals, communities, and societies. It is through education that we can empower ourselves with knowledge, skills, and values necessary to make informed decisions and take control of our lives. Unfortunately, many girls around the world are denied this basic human right due to various reasons such as poverty, lack of access to schools, and cultural beliefs.

Education is not only a means to acquire knowledge but also a powerful tool for social change. It has been proven that educated women are more likely to participate in the workforce, earn higher salaries, and contribute positively to their communities. Moreover, education helps to break the cycle of poverty by providing individuals with the skills and resources necessary to improve their socio-economic status.

In conclusion, it is imperative that we prioritize education as a means to empower girls and women. We must work together to ensure that every girl has access to quality education, regardless of her background or circumstances.

Challenges Faced by Girls in Education

Despite the importance of education, many girls around the world face numerous challenges that hinder their ability to access quality education. These challenges include lack of access to schools, especially in rural and remote areas, poverty, and cultural beliefs that restrict girls' participation in education.

Additionally, there are also social and economic barriers that prevent girls from pursuing their educational goals. For instance, early marriage and pregnancy, child labor, and gender-based violence are all significant obstacles that can disrupt a girl's education.

It is essential that we address these challenges head-on by providing support to schools, communities, and governments to ensure that every girl has access to quality education
